    My son have been raving about this Poke spot. He said it's just as good as the poke we had in…read moreHawaii. I have to agree! We came on a Sunday around lunch time. The place was pretty busy with tables mostly occupied. We were ordering to go and the wait was about 10 minutes or so. We both got the poke bowl and these are the steps. 1. Select a base - Sushi rice, Brown rice or Spring mix salad. 2. Select 2 flavors. There are about 12 options of Ahi, Salmon and Shrimp. It was my first time and I always like to go with their recommendations, which is Furikake Bomb Ahi and Salmon Bomb. Great names because they were bombs! 3. Select Loaded Options aka toppings! I like that you pick a style which includes a set of toppings, instead of selecting the toppings individually. I bet that saves a lot of time. We both got the Delilah's Style which has seaweed salad, cucumbers, surimi crab, wonton chips, edamame, mangoes, massago, furikake and unagi sauce. If you like it spicy, I would get the Tropical Style with spicy mayo. Ahi and Salmon were fresh with mild (but tasty) seasoning that's not too much that you can still taste the fish. I absolutely love the wonton chips. This is not the typical wonton chips. Incredibly crunchy and thicker pieces. The toppings are vibrant, fresh and delicious! The portions are generous. I couldn't finish it in one sitting. Next time I go back I want to try the sushi wrap and musubis. This is a hidden gem in Davis.

    Found my go-to poke spot and I'm not even mad about it. The Poke (Regular) gets you three generous…read morescoops, and "generous" is underselling it. The Hawaiian Ahi Tuna and that F&T Mix (the pre-marinated ahi and salmon combo) taste like they were cut that morning. Genuinely fresh, no fishy aftertaste, just clean and buttery. Seating is a nice surprise too. Plenty of room inside if you want the AC, but the patio is where it's at on a nice day. They've also got a solid drink selection, so you're not stuck choosing between two sad fridge options. The staff make it. Friendly without being over the top, quick to answer questions if you're new to building a bowl, and they actually seem happy you're there. For the portion size and quality you're getting, the price is more than fair. This is hands down my favorite place for poke in the area, and I'll be back before the week's out. Five stars, easy.

    I've been coming to Fish & Things since they first opened their doors, and I've been satisfied with…read moreevery poke bowl, and sushi roll I've ordered. Their prices have gone up over the years, but the quality and freshness of the fish are still there. Some of my favorite sushi rolls are the Smokey Peyton and Bruceville Roll, as well as their Salmon Lover Roll -- it's refreshing and light. Their poke bowls are another favorite of mine. I usually like to build mine and go with the spicy salmon and their spicy tuna and salmon mix as my protein choices. You can also order their poke à la carte -- 1 lb is $18. If you're looking for good quality poke or sushi for takeout or party platters, this place is worth checking out.
